It's an alpha emitter (and if being used in a university classroom, probably a sealed one). Unless you eat it, the danger is not comparable. Radium, in contrast, emits gamma radiation, which presents more of a threat to casual bystanders. All of which is to say: you can't just compare "radioactivity" levels and extrapolate to "danger".

I'm more scared of alpha than gamma. If the alpha source gets tampered with and becomes a dust somehow, it could stay in someone's lungs, and kill someone without being easily detectable. Cheap eBay Geiger counters will probably tell you if gamma rays are an immediate danger, and if you're close enough to have problems, your probably also close enough to detect it.

> I'm more scared of alpha than gamma. If the alpha source gets tampered with and becomes a dust somehow, it could stay in someone's lungs, and kill someone without being easily detectable.

It's not an either/or sort of thing. Gamma decay occurs after alpha or beta decay, so a gamma source will also emit alpha or beta radiation. In the case of Cs-137, it emits a lot of beta radiation. Normally this is shielded, but normally it doesn't fall off a truck..

Radiation detection is my specialty. This source is Cs-137, few hundred mCi. It's easy to detect within a few seconds at distances of a few tens of meters or more with professional detection equipment if there is direct line of sight. If it was knocked off the road, though, the question will be if it fell into a crack or other such place because then the radiation is somewhat shielded and it would take much more meas…

If a critter moved it or ate it then it's probably gone forever. At a distance of 1 meter the dose rate from that source is already not extremely hazardous unless a person were exposed for an extended period of time (like a full day or two). Getting closer, like putting it directly against your torso, would mean serious health effects in a matter of minutes.

Bit of contradiction in your statement here? If putting it against your torso would mean serious health effects in minutes, how would a critter "eat" it and get more than a few meters away?

I guess by minutes you mean tens of minutes?
